Transaction 5066f5ac5a18e0196103364aa50319081eecda15803764f9f65bdb898b837b85
1 Input
1 Output
-
5066f5ac5a18e0196103364aa50319081eecda15803764f9f65bdb898b837b85:0
- value
- 184381
- script pubkey
- OP_0 OP_PUSHBYTES_20 52cbbfd26f57b8073d8a167c36e1500dbda9cec2
- address
- bc1q2t9ml5n027uqw0v2ze7rdc2spk76nnkzcdyt5w